Sleepless domain is a story about magical girls. A great barrier protects the city from the nightmares lurking beyond. Within, everyone can live out safe and comfortable lives - except for a few hours around midnight, when the outer barrier weakens and monsters roam the city streets, trying to break into the buildings and prey on the people inside. The inner barrier protects the city buildings themselves, but it needs to be guarded by magical girls - teenagers who were given a dream, in which they were granted their power. Although, like all dreams, no one remembers all the details. Each night, hundreds of girls risk their lives in defence of the city. In return, they are celebrated; the whole city follows their lives and exploits. Everyone has their favourites, and shows their support by buying their merchandise. Such is life for a magical girl. Undine, known by her title of Alchemical Water, was once part of Team Alchemical - until a patrol goes bad and she is left the only one still active. Now she's looking for the strange apparition that taunted her as she lay dying. She joins up with Heartful Punch, a very successful solo girl, as she tries to make sense of how her world works and keep everyone around her safe. Sleepless Domain is written and drawn by Mary Cagle, of Kiwi Blitz and Let's Speak English fame. Weaving together rich characters, dark mysteries and pretty outfits, if the idea of a magical girl story that isn't aimed at children or paedophiles appeals to you, give it a read!
